PENSACOLA, Fla.- It another great day at the Ralph "Skeeter" Carson Tennis Complex as the No. 7 West Florida men's tennis team dominated XULA 6-1 on Saturday for senior day.
With today's win, the Argos improve to 12-2 and stretch their at home win streak to seven.
HOW IT HAPPENED
UWF dominated in doubles with wins from two positions.
Tomas Descarrega and
Facundo Bermejo were the first to finish with a 6-2 win from the No. 1 position.
Albin Ekenros and Adam Svennson dropped their match 6-3 to Julius Hell and Mathieu Strass as the No. 2 pair.
It all came down to
Bernardo Costa and
Enzo Bomfim Silveira to clinch the doubles point. The pair won in a tiebreaker 7-6 (9-7) to secure the lone doubles point.
In between singles and doubles, head coach
Derrick Racine and his coaching staff honored the seniors including seniors
Facundo Bermejo,
Tomas Descarrega,
Enzo Bomfim Silveira,
Adam Svensson, and
Bernardo Costa.
The momentum from doubles carried over to singles. Bermejo dominated his match 6-4, 6-3 in No. 3 singles. Descarrega was victorious 6-4, 6-4 from the No. 1 position over Jacobi Bain.
Costa dropped his match 7-5, 6-0 from the No. 3 position.
From the bottom half of the lineup,
Sebastian Rondon won his match due to retirement by the Golden Nuggets player. Rondon was ahead 4-0 in the second set before the match concluded.
Joaquin Estevez and Silveira won their match from the No. 5 and No. 6 singles to clinch the match for the Argos. Estevez came up with the win 6-1, 6-1 from the No. 5 position while Silveira won 6-1, 4-6, 10-4 as No. 6.
